MOORHEAD, Minn. — The Minnesota State University Moorhead volleyball program has announced the signing of five student-athletes for the 2020 season.
Here's a look at the Dragon recruits.
Jordan Hein (S/DS, 5-7, Galesville, Wis./Gale-Ettrick-Trempealeau HS)
First-team all-conference as a junior…team MVP…honorable mention all-conference in 2017…played for Hawk Xtreme in LaCrosse for seven years…four-year letterwinner in volleyball.
Brielle Kallberg (MB, 5-11, Ely, Minn./Ely HS)
Has more than 1,200 career kills…all-conference and Duluth News All-Area in volleyball…school record holder for kills and digs…six-year letterwinner…also has scored more than 1,000 points in basketball and is a multiple-time state participant in track.
Kelly Klees (S/RS, 5-11, Rochester, Minn./Mayo HS)
Finished with 1,758 career assists, 688 digs and 470 kills…two-time all-conference…team captain…part of state tournament team…five-year letterwinner in volleyball…played six years for Southern Minnesota Volleyball Junior Olympic Squad and earned all-tournament honors at 2018 National Junior Classic.
Lexi Pew (Middle Blocker, 5-11, Chokio, Minn./Chokio-Alberta HS)
All-conference first team selection for Morris Area/Chokio-Alberta squad…West Central Conference's Most Valuable Hitter…has single-game career-highs of 25 kills and eight solo blocks…team captain…had 403 blocks over final two years of high school…three-year letter winner in volleyball.
Summer Salettel (MB/OH, 6-0, Beaver Dam, Wis./Beaver Dam HS)
First-team all-conference as a senior…second-team all-conference as a junior…two-year varsity captain…has recorded more than 700 career kills…also closing in on 250 career blocks…three-year letterwinner.
